Internal Memo — Drone Return for Servicing

To: Records Team

Unit D-7 of the Skerrow inspection fleet was returned yesterday after a motor fault flagged during the Harlowe Quarry survey. Flight logs have been exported and filed; the airframe is packed in its transit case in the equipment room. Varnell Dynamics will collect it for servicing on Wednesday. Update the asset register before release and retain a copy of the manifest. Release the case to the courier only per the instruction below.

courier memo of fajeg-yagag: the pramir keleth courier leaves the wenax holox ralix ledger at gate 8171 under passcode 428648

FAQ: What are Pingloom's webhook retry semantics?

Short version: we retry failed deliveries with exponential backoff, up to eight attempts over 24 hours. Each retry is signed fresh, so replay checks still hold. If the receiving endpoint's vault is sealed, retries pause. To resume, an operator unseals it with the recovery passphrase shown directly below this answer.

vault phrase of bagaf-kajeg = jorath-feniel-briir-siliel-ralix

Subject: KeyTurner rotation utility — new build out

Hi all (and welcome, Priya-from-contracting!) — we've shipped a fresh KeyTurner build that fixes the double-rotation bug some of you hit last week. Nothing changes in your workflow: same commands, same config file. If a rotation stalls, just rerun with --resume rather than starting over. For anything weird, ping the release channel and paste the build token below.

build token for kagaf-hahof: htk14_9d3d4d26d7d8de

**Q: What happens when Mailcull marks a bounce as permanent?**

Mailcull, our email bounce processor, classifies hard bounces after three consecutive failures and suppresses the address automatically. Soft bounces are retried for 72 hours. If the suppression list itself becomes corrupted, restore it from the encrypted nightly snapshot in the Thornfield backup bucket. Restoring requires the team recovery passphrase, which is kept directly below this entry for emergencies.

unlock words, kahof-bahap: praax-ulaix